Ghost of Yothe It surprised viewers with the reveal, as Sucker Punch revealed that Jin Sakai will not be the protagonist of the long-awaited sequel. In fact, Jin won't be in the game at all. Because it takes place hundreds of years after the events of the first game. And it's in a completely different region in Japan. While some see this upheaval as a welcome experiment and subversion. But some people are less confident and disappointed that Jin will not return. This sentiment reflects the public's reception to Red Dead Redemption 2 Ahead of launch it was revealed that there would be playable characters besides the famous John Marston from the first game. As many People agree that This was a great decision on Rockstar's part; Perhaps Sucker Punch made a similarly good call here.

The sequel to Sucker Punch's Ghost of Tsushima, Ghost of Yōtei is a PS5 exclusive slated for release in 2025. Set in 1603, the story will feature a new protagonist and a new region in Japan that is far away. Tsushima's scene
